Output 5cb8206954e0829a66ddf8a65452da77d35b4c0d6787e89affeeacb51504a6bd:2

value
7969799
script pubkey
OP_0 OP_PUSHBYTES_20 e66f3764d05898e6c15e2306e2325c94d0ef379b
address
tb1quehnwexstzvwds27yvrwyvjujngw7dum7f2m40
transaction
5cb8206954e0829a66ddf8a65452da77d35b4c0d6787e89affeeacb51504a6bd
confirmations
15557
spent
true